Definitions:

Monitor Employees

The practice of overseeing employees' activities and performance in the workplace through various methods, including surveillance tools or performance metrics, to ensure productivity and compliance.

Company Email

A digital communication tool assigned to employees for professional use within a company.

Salting

A tactic used by unions in which union members seek employment at non-union workplaces to organize from within and encourage unionization.

Union Election

A formal voting process in which workers decide whether to establish a union as their representative for collective bargaining with their employer.
